What Measures Should You Take to Use Water Heaters
Warm water is an everyday need for each family members, whether for a long, calming bath, washing, or food preparation. Warm water can also conserve you from some unpleasant situations, for instance, a clogged commode.
That said, water heaters are not without threats. These pro pointers will help you as well as your household make use of a water heater appropriately as well as securely.

Inspect your Stress and also Temperature Level Shutoffs


Your hot water heater's temperature and pressure valves manage the temperature and also pressure within the hot water heater tank. These valves will certainly avoid an explosion if your tank gets also hot or if the stress surpasses secure degrees.
However, these safety and security gadgets offer no warning when they spoil. You can validate your valve's effectiveness by holding on to the shutoff's bar. If it is in good condition, water ought to flow out. If no water drains or only a flow is launched, hurry as well as obtain your valves fixed.

Wait numerous hrs for the water container to warm up


It will take your hot water heater a number of hours to entirely heat up, so inspect it periodically by activating a tap to make sure it's getting warm. The advised temperature level is 120 ° F (49 ° C.

Check for fire risks.


As you check your valves, offer its surroundings an once over. Check the location for fire dangers, especially if you use a gas-powered water heater.
Initially, check for combustible materials like fuel, gas storage tanks, and also various other heat-generating appliances. Next, check for littles paper and wood, consisting of trash. Do not take care of your garbage close to your hot water heater equipment.
You would certainly succeed to maintain any type of clothing far from your water heater. Ought to a fire start, these products will certainly promote its spread. That said, your laundry line should not be close to your hot water heater.

Always preserve correct air flow.


If your hot water heater isn't correctly vented, it'll lead fumes right into your house. This could trigger respiratory system issues and also provide you cough or an allergic reaction.
A great air vent ought to encounter up or have a vertical angle, leading the smoke far from the household. If your vent does not follow this style, it might be a setup mistake.
You require a plumber's help to take care of inadequate hot water heater air flow.

Secure your tools from children.


Your gas heating system's tools is sensitive. It is not enough to eliminate combustible material. You ought to safeguard your kids from possible mishaps, and safeguard your water heater from children's curiosity. Apply a safety zone about 3ft around your hot water heater. You might mark the area out with red tape or simply enlighten your youngsters on why steering clear of from the funny-looking equipment is best for them.
If you've got a serious situation of curious cats, you might provide a well-coordinated excursion of the home heating tools and also just how it helps them get the best bathrooms!

Teach your family just how to switch off the water heater.


Throughout this trip, reveal your family members exactly how to turn off the heating system, especially if it is a gas heating unit. They must likewise recognize when to transform it off. For instance, if there is a gas leakage, if the water pressure goes down as well low, or if the water heater is overheating. You should likewise switch off your water heater when you'll be away for a couple of days, and also when the tank is vacant.

Constantly pre-programmed the optimum temperature.


Warm water burns in your home prevail. You can protect against crashes, save power and respect the atmosphere merely by presetting your hot water heater's maximum temperature. The most convenient hot water temperature level is 120F. Water at this temperature level is safe for adults, kids, as well as the elderly.

Tips to Increase the Lifespan of your Water Heater


Turn OFF the geyser when not in use


Turn the geyser off when you are done using it. It will help decrease power consumption, extend lifespan, and save money on water heater repair. The water does not turn cold, even after switching the geyser off, as the storage tank holds the temperature of the water for 4-5 hours.


Proper Installation


Proper space should be left around the water heater. It should not feel crowded, and giving room to breathe increases airflow and reduces the risk of fires. This gives you optimal space for completing routine system maintenance checks without difficulty. Nothing should be kept near or under the geyser. The geyser should be installed away from wet areas, like the bathtub, shower, or toilet.


Insulate your Water Heater


Insulation should be installed around the pipes and the water heater to make it more energy efficient and to increase the water temperature by 2-4 degrees. During the summertime, this keeps the pipes from sweating or forming condensation. It can also protect your cold water pipes from freezing and potentially bursting during cooler months. Insulation may cut heat loss by as much as 45% and your expenditures for overheating the water.


Replace the Sacrificial Anode


Water heaters are equipped with a sacrificial anode to prevent corrosion by hard water. The anode rod protects the tank from rusting on the inside and should be checked yearly. Without a rod or a properly functioning anode rod, the hot water quickly corrodes inside the tank. It can last anywhere from five to ten years. However, the amount of water you use and the hardness of your water determines its need for replacement.


Install a Water Softener


f you live in an area where the mineral content is high in the water systems, then installing a water softener might help expand the lifespan of your water heater. When an area has high mineral content (calcium and magnesium) in the water, it’s known as hard water. Hard water leaves deposits to form at the bottom of the water heater, which causes them to have problems much sooner than expected. To prevent this from happening, install a water softener that filters out the minerals that make the water hard, allowing only soft water to flow through the pipes.


Lower the Temperature


Lowering the temperature of your geyser will help you save electricity, increase its life, and the geyser will have to work less. Maintaining a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it to eradicate the vast majority of pathogens is a good thumb rule. The hotter your hot water supply is, the more energy it will consume.
